• Implement and refine the Payroll Operations strategy in collaboration with the broader People team.
• Carry out the collection, calculation, and input of payroll information.
• Respond to employee inquiries and issues regarding compensation and attendance tracking.
• Update payroll documentation and generate payroll reports.
• Create and document repeatable, scalable payroll processes along with employee-facing guidelines and procedures.
• Collaborate with Accounting to ensure accurate job costing and general ledger maintenance.
• Generate and evaluate employee data reports.
• Oversee payroll tax accounts, including filing and establishing new accounts.
• Reconcile taxes between Workday and ADP, file quarterly tax returns, and verify tax rates.
• Create and review company tax reports.
• Safeguard the integrity and confidentiality of human resources records, documents, and policies.
• Stay informed about payroll trends, best practices, and regulatory updates.
• Assist employees with inquiries related to People Payroll while delivering outstanding customer service.
• Facilitate and support employee onboarding and offboarding processes.
